XIII-Death

XIII-Death

When I first saw Brae’s modeling page I knew that she had to be my death card. She had the perfect look for what I had envisioned for it. Exotic, sexy. Reminiscent of Neil Gaiman’s Death, but a little more dangerous. I had the base idea for what i wanted to do in mind when I first wrote her, and I’m pretty happy with how it turned out.

I went back and forth as to how ghostly I wanted to make her. I considered putting tombstones directly behind her so that you could really see right through her, but the ultimately decided that that would ruin a rule I had set for the deck when I first started. Don’t let the background overwhelm the model. It’s something that I really feel about photography in general, actually, which is why I am so fond of the solid black background look.

XVIII – The Moon

XVIII - The Moon

The fourth completed card in my tarot card series.

Mallory as the Moon. I had originally envisioned this as a card where she was standing and looking at the moon, but as we were shooting yesterday, she got tired of standing and wanted to shoot some sitting down. I really loved her head placement in this one and the arch of her back. I think the facial expression is perfect for what I wanted to convey.

The biggest thing I am unsure of is the placement of the moon. When I took the pic of the moon last week, I really had envisioned her looking at it, not away, but I do feel as though it kind of works how it is. Not positive though.
